  • Ensuring that fresh ingredients and supplies are available when daily production starts in the early morning hours.
  • Monitoring the material issuing process and ensuring that materials are issued only according to the standard given by the Manager.
  • Establishing a professional brand, consistent image and stellar reputation for the company.
  • Maintaining daily attendance records.
  • Planning and coordinating administrative procedures and systems and devising ways to streamline processes.
  • Ensuring the smooth and adequate flow of information within the organization to facilitate business operations.
  • Booking and arranging travel, transportation, and accommodation.
  • Typing, compiling and preparing reports, presentations, and correspondences.
  • Authorizing fuel vouchers for the release of fuel to office vehicles and monitoring its usage.
  • Monitoring costs and expenses to assist the Manager in budget preparation.
  • Monitoring inventory of office supplies and the purchase of new materials paying full attention to budgetary constraints.
  • Receiving visitors and directing them to the appropriate offices.
  • Ensuring that the office and company environment is thoroughly clean and presentable.
  • Ensuring that operations adhere to the company’s policies and regulations.
  • Liaising with vendors and suppliers on behalf of the company.
  • Acting as the first point of contact and dealing with correspondence and phone calls.
  • Preparing weekly reports on material usage, office cleaning schedule, maintenance sheet and fuel reconciliation sheet.
  • Managing diaries, organizing meetings and appointments; often controlling access to the Manager.
  • Managing databases and filing systems for proper recording, documentation and safekeeping of files and records.
  • Collating and filing expenses incurred in the operation of the business.
